What is Decomposition?
Decomposition is the breakdown of organic matter after death. It is a complex series of chemical and biological processes that occur naturally, primarily driven by bacteria and other microorganisms.
Stage 1: Fresh Stage
The first stage of decomposition begins immediately after death. During this stage, the body still appears relatively unchanged externally, but internal processes have already begun. Cells start to lose their oxygen supply, and the body’s temperature begins to drop, matching the ambient temperature.
- Bloat Stage
After a few days, the body enters the bloat stage. Gases produced by bacteria and other organisms accumulate within the body, causing it to swell and, in some cases, even burst. This is a visually striking stage of decomposition.
Stage 2: Active Decay
As the body moves into the active decay stage, it starts to show prominent signs of decomposition. The skin turns discolored, and the body releases fluids due to the breakdown of tissues. Strong odors become apparent as bacteria continue to break down the body.
- Advanced Decay
At this point, the body progresses into the advanced decay stage. The tissues and organs continue to break down, and the remains may appear blackened or mummified. Insects and scavengers play a crucial role in accelerating decomposition during this phase.
Stage 3: Skeletonization
During the final stage of decomposition, known as skeletonization, only the hard tissues, such as bones, cartilage, and teeth, remain. The soft tissues are mostly gone, having been consumed by scavengers and decomposers.
Factors Affecting Decomposition
Several factors can influence the speed and progression of human body decomposition. Temperature, humidity, access to oxygen, burial depth, and presence of insects or scavengers can all impact the process. Different environments will yield varying rates and patterns of decay.
Legal and Forensic Significance
Understanding the process of human body decomposition plays a crucial role in various legal and forensic investigations. Estimating the time of death, determining if foul play was involved, and identifying potential evidence are some of the key applications of studying decomposition.
